Bassinets may be used throughout the new child phase till your baby has the capacity to transfer all around, push up on their own palms or roll around, commonly involving three months and 6 months old. Some bassinets have excess weight restrictions too, which range depending upon the model you buy.

A fast note about our screening: Our testers checked out how effortless Each individual merchandise would be to assemble (What number of parts and methods does it have?); what functions it has (Will it Use a movement aspect? A shelf for diaper storage?); and how convenient the products is to work with, normally (Could it be straightforward to accessibility your baby? Is the peak adjustable?). We looked at the bassinets from numerous safety angles. 1st, we ensured that every bassinet adheres to federal protection tips. We made use of an inclinometer in order that the bassinets by no means reached an incline ten per cent or larger, that may be perilous for your baby’s airflow.
